U.S. Conducts 16th Eastern Pacific Drone Strike Killing 2 Suspected Narco-Terrorists

The United States military executed its 16th drone strike in the eastern Pacific Ocean, resulting in the deaths of two suspected drug smugglers aboard a vessel linked to a designated terrorist organization. The operation, ordered by President Donald Trump, was conducted in international waters and marked the administration’s continued focus on targeting drug trafficking routes into the United States. This strike is part of a broader campaign that has seen at least 66 suspected narco-terrorists killed, with three surviving the attacks so far.
